SkyData: Managing your data in the cloud
Filed in archive Online Services by Rom Feria on September 13, 2008
Over at the recently concluded DEMOFall 2008, SkyData Systems announces the private beta status of their new service. What SkyData does is to provide a single point of entry for users to manage and maintain their social network data as well as data hosted in CRM service providers such as SalesForce, SugarCRM, etc.



This seems to be a one-stop shop in managing all your calendars, contacts, e-mail, calls, SMS, etc. Whilst the service is available on the Blackberry and Windows Mobile, an iPhone version will be out soon.

Currently on private beta, you can sign-up so that you'd get notified when you can register and start using the service. According to the site, the service is free for personal use with the business edition costing at USD9.95/month. Not bad, huh? Can't wait to test this out.
